Province Achaea
Region Phocis
City Delphi
Reign Antoninus Pius
Person (obv.) Faustina I (Diva)
Obverse inscription ΘΕΑ ΦΑΥϹΤΕΙΝΑ
Edition Θεὰ Φαυστεῖνα
Translation goddess Faustina
Obverse design draped bust of the deified Faustina I, right
Reverse inscription ΔΕΛΦΩΝ
Edition Δελφῶν
Translation of the Delphians
Reverse design temple with six columns; in central intercolumnation E
Metal copper-based alloy
Average diameter 19 mm
Average weight 3.98 g
Axis 7, 9, 12
Reference Svoronos, Delphi 88, F. Imhoof-Blumer, ZfN I (1874), 115, no. 4
Specimens 3 (2 in the core collections)
